Output 33ba7b573206507cb5a100db793c9cc990f5e095d67c4d152e63f483c1023c55:0

value
32081203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86650e6ebe701f5aad3bb78c972f324c021681d2 OP_EQUAL
address
3DwdXmZv2EMiyugoy1eUmkVNrRqnVgAZS6
transaction
33ba7b573206507cb5a100db793c9cc990f5e095d67c4d152e63f483c1023c55
spent
true